- #!/usr/bin/env python
- # Copyright 2015 The Chromium Authors. All rights reserved.
- # Use of this source code is governed by a BSD-style license that can be
- # found in the LICENSE file.
- """Runs 'ld -shared' and generates a .TOC file that's untouched when unchanged.
- This script exists to avoid using complex shell commands in
- gcc_toolchain.gni's tool("solink"), in case the host running the compiler
- does not have a POSIX-like shell (e.g. Windows).
- """
- import argparse
- import os
- import shlex
- import subprocess
- import sys
- import wrapper_utils
- def CollectSONAME(args):
- """Replaces: readelf -d $sofile | grep SONAME"""
- # TODO(crbug.com/1259067): Come up with a way to get this info without having
- # to bundle readelf in the toolchain package.
- toc = ''
- readelf = subprocess.Popen(wrapper_utils.CommandToRun(
- [args.readelf, '-d', args.sofile]),
- stdout=subprocess.PIPE,
- bufsize=-1,
- universal_newlines=True)
- for line in readelf.stdout:
- if 'SONAME' in line:
- toc += line
- return readelf.wait(), toc
- def CollectDynSym(args):
- """Replaces: nm --format=posix -g -D -p $sofile | cut -f1-2 -d' '"""
- toc = ''
- nm = subprocess.Popen(wrapper_utils.CommandToRun(
- [args.nm, '--format=posix', '-g', '-D', '-p', args.sofile]),
- stdout=subprocess.PIPE,
- bufsize=-1,
- universal_newlines=True)
- for line in nm.stdout:
- toc += ' '.join(line.split(' ', 2)[:2]) + '\n'
- return nm.wait(), toc
- def CollectTOC(args):
- result, toc = CollectSONAME(args)
- if result == 0:
- result, dynsym = CollectDynSym(args)
- toc += dynsym
- return result, toc
- def UpdateTOC(tocfile, toc):
- if os.path.exists(tocfile):
- old_toc = open(tocfile, 'r').read()
- else:
- old_toc = None
- if toc != old_toc:
- open(tocfile, 'w').write(toc)
- def CollectInputs(out, args):
- for x in args:
- if x.startswith('@'):
- with open(x[1:]) as rsp:
- CollectInputs(out, shlex.split(rsp.read()))
- elif not x.startswith('-') and (x.endswith('.o') or x.endswith('.a')):
- out.write(x)
- out.write('\n')
- def InterceptFlag(flag, command):
- ret = flag in command
- if ret:
- command.remove(flag)
- return ret
- def SafeDelete(path):
- try:
- os.unlink(path)
- except OSError:
- pass
- def main():
- parser = argparse.ArgumentParser(description=__doc__)
- parser.add_argument('--readelf',
- required=True,
- help='The readelf binary to run',
- metavar='PATH')
- parser.add_argument('--nm',
- required=True,
- help='The nm binary to run',
- metavar='PATH')
- parser.add_argument('--strip',
- help='The strip binary to run',
- metavar='PATH')
- parser.add_argument('--dwp', help='The dwp binary to run', metavar='PATH')
- parser.add_argument('--sofile',
- required=True,
- help='Shared object file produced by linking command',
- metavar='FILE')
- parser.add_argument('--tocfile',
- required=True,
- help='Output table-of-contents file',
- metavar='FILE')
- parser.add_argument('--map-file',
- help=('Use --Wl,-Map to generate a map file. Will be '
- 'gzipped if extension ends with .gz'),
- metavar='FILE')
- parser.add_argument('--output',
- required=True,
- help='Final output shared object file',
- metavar='FILE')
- parser.add_argument('command', nargs='+',
- help='Linking command')
- args = parser.parse_args()
- # Work-around for gold being slow-by-default. http://crbug.com/632230
- fast_env = dict(os.environ)
- fast_env['LC_ALL'] = 'C'
- # Extract flags passed through ldflags but meant for this script.
- # https://crbug.com/954311 tracks finding a better way to plumb these.
- partitioned_library = InterceptFlag('--partitioned-library', args.command)
- collect_inputs_only = InterceptFlag('--collect-inputs-only', args.command)
- # Partitioned .so libraries are used only for splitting apart in a subsequent
- # step.
- #
- # - The TOC file optimization isn't useful, because the partition libraries
- # must always be re-extracted if the combined library changes (and nothing
- # should be depending on the combined library's dynamic symbol table).
- # - Stripping isn't necessary, because the combined library is not used in
- # production or published.
- #
- # Both of these operations could still be done, they're needless work, and
- # tools would need to be updated to handle and/or not complain about
- # partitioned libraries. Instead, to keep Ninja happy, simply create dummy
- # files for the TOC and stripped lib.
- if collect_inputs_only or partitioned_library:
- open(args.output, 'w').close()
- open(args.tocfile, 'w').close()
- # Instead of linking, records all inputs to a file. This is used by
- # enable_resource_allowlist_generation in order to avoid needing to
- # link (which is slow) to build the resources allowlist.
- if collect_inputs_only:
- if args.map_file:
- open(args.map_file, 'w').close()
- if args.dwp:
- open(args.sofile + '.dwp', 'w').close()
- with open(args.sofile, 'w') as f:
- CollectInputs(f, args.command)
- return 0
- # First, run the actual link.
- command = wrapper_utils.CommandToRun(args.command)
- result = wrapper_utils.RunLinkWithOptionalMapFile(command,
- env=fast_env,
- map_file=args.map_file)
- if result != 0:
- return result
- # If dwp is set, then package debug info for this SO.
- dwp_proc = None
- if args.dwp:
- # Explicit delete to account for symlinks (when toggling between
- # debug/release).
- SafeDelete(args.sofile + '.dwp')
- # Suppress warnings about duplicate CU entries (https://crbug.com/1264130)
- dwp_proc = subprocess.Popen(wrapper_utils.CommandToRun(
- [args.dwp, '-e', args.sofile, '-o', args.sofile + '.dwp']),
- stderr=subprocess.DEVNULL)
- if not partitioned_library:
- # Next, generate the contents of the TOC file.
- result, toc = CollectTOC(args)
- if result != 0:
- return result
- # If there is an existing TOC file with identical contents, leave it alone.
- # Otherwise, write out the TOC file.
- UpdateTOC(args.tocfile, toc)
- # Finally, strip the linked shared object file (if desired).
- if args.strip:
- result = subprocess.call(
- wrapper_utils.CommandToRun(
- [args.strip, '-o', args.output, args.sofile]))
- if dwp_proc:
- dwp_result = dwp_proc.wait()
- if dwp_result != 0:
- sys.stderr.write('dwp failed with error code {}\n'.format(dwp_result))
- return dwp_result
- return result
- if __name__ == "__main__":
- sys.exit(main())
